
Developing novel algorithms and foundations for discrete structures, including AI, graph algorithms and discrete optimization
This group works to improve and expand the functionality of existing computational algorithms to make them compatible with the novel architectures of upcoming supercomputers, as well as to optimize them for fields of particular interest to the Department of Energy, including neuromorphic computing and quantum computing.
By developing advanced algorithms for high-performance computing systems, this group enables researchers to obtain results in seconds instead of days and thus accelerate the transition from simulations to practical experiments and real-world applications.
